'mkdir'에 해당되는 글 1건

  1. 2007.04.25 [Pro*C] mkdir by pino93

[Pro*C] mkdir

Program/Pro*c 2007.04.25 08:11

/*-----------------------------------------------------------------------------

  FUNCTION    : MkDir

-----------------------------------------------------------------------------*/

intMkDir(char* pFname)

{

   intrval;

   inti;

   charcFull[512];


   if(pFname[0]==0)

       returnNO;

   elseif(access(pFname,0)==0)

       returnYES;


    cFull[0]=pFname[0];


   for(i=1; i<strlen(pFname); i++)

    {

       if( pFname[i]==_DIR_)

        {

           if( access(cFull,0)!=0 )

            {

                rval=mkdir(cFull,-1);

               if( rval != 0 )

                   return(ERR);

            }

        }

        cFull[i]=pFname[i];

        cFull[i+1]=0;

    }


   if( access(cFull,0)!=0 )

    {

        rval=mkdir(cFull,-1);

       if( rval!=0 )

           return(ERR);

    }

   return(OK);

}


해당 경로를 생성해주는 함수

'Program > Pro*c' 카테고리의 다른 글

[Pro*C, C] 문자스트링이 실제로 숫자인지 확인 함수  (0) 2007.06.15
[Pro*C, C] Mk Dir Function  (0) 2007.06.15
[Pro*C] mkdir  (0) 2007.04.25
[Pro*C] 파일읽기  (0) 2007.04.25
[Pro*C] substr  (0) 2007.04.25
[Pro*C, C] 표준출력함수 printf()  (0) 2007.04.21
Posted by pino93
TAG ,